PROCESS AND ITS APPLICATION FOR IMPROVING REPRODUCIBILITY IN MALDI-TOF GLYCAN PROFILING OF HUMAN SERUM: EXPERIMENTAL PROCEDURE AND APPLICATION TO THE SCREENING FOR OVARIAN TUMORS

Disclosed is that the most crucial point in the quantitative analysis of MALDI-TOF MS is to minimize quantitative variances (RSDs, relative standard deviations) of peak intensities of obtained spectrum data. The minimized RSD is translated into improved reproducibility of the data and finally leads to high accuracy of the results. Several technical procedures based on the concept of automatization to reduce the RSDs (to less than 10%) in the MALDI-TOF MS of serum glycans were proposed for the preparation steps of extracting the targeted glycans from human blood and sample loading processes onto the plates. The presented techniques described in the examples proved the contributions of the present invention to enhanced reproducibility of the MALDI-TOF MS and consequently to improved screening accuracy for the differentiation of the benign ovarian tumor patients from the borderline ovarian tumor patients in comparison with accuracy of differentiation based on other analysis methods.
